Great experience with Kenan! We were just a small group. He took the time to chat with everyone. The ride on the Tamarin River is beautiful, we were even lucky enough to see monkeys!

The dolphin-watching kayak tour in Tamarin Bay was a particularly enriching experience. We sailed through the bay and were able to observe dolphins. The guide was very friendly and gave us some information about dolphins in Mauritius. It was particularly appreciated that they took care not to disturb them. I am delighted that this kayak tour offers a sustainable and animal-friendly way to observe dolphins without disturbing them with noisy motorboats like other providers. The price of €35 per person is definitely worth it!
